Door ajar issues
 
2000 Mitsu Monty
Door starting acting up around a year ago and I sprayed a little lithium in he door catch itself and the problem went away. However, recently the door ajar light seems to have came back on as well as the dome lights. Im not sure but I think it might be playing a roll with my alarm as well cause it seems that maybe with the ajar light being on the alarm my possibly not be arming right? Dont know.

So, does anyone know or have experienced this issue before or know a way to fish this? Thank you.

HunterD 05-22-2016 11:04 PM

Perhaps it is the switch rather than the door lock?

sumpump_1203 05-22-2016 11:27 PM


Originally Posted by HunterD (Post 315935)
Perhaps it is the switch rather than the door lock?

Switch as in? Im sorry, not really sure what you mean but that. Are you talking about the door jamb pin?

HunterD 05-23-2016 11:29 AM

The switch in the door frame that is activated when the door is open. Look around the door frame it is usually a small button switch often covered by a rubber protective seal. It can be shorting out and that is why you have false readings for "door ajar".
